Overview of the Test Chamber
The carbon arc lamp artificial aging test chamber mainly uses daylight-type carbon arc lamps as the light source. By adjusting temperature (sample rack temperature, working chamber temperature), relative humidity, rainfall methods, etc., it simulates the comprehensive combination of light, heat, and water under outdoor climate test conditions to conduct artificial aging tests on the photochemical energy and mechanical properties of test materials. Key control parameters including light irradiance, working chamber temperature, sample rack temperature, and relative humidity are automatically controlled through closed-loop systems. The instrument adopts an advanced PLC controller, ensuring stable and reliable control; it provides various alarm messages during operation for easy maintenance. This device complies with domestic carbon arc lamp aging test standards as well as international standards such as AATCC, ISO, DIN, and ASTM. It has a wide range of applications, including plastics, coatings, rubber, textiles, automobiles, building materials, etc. The control system of this instrument consists of: carbon arc lamp automatic control system; carbon arc lamp cooling system; temperature control system; humidity control system; and carbon arc lamp protection alarm system.

Light Irradiance
| Carbon Arc Lamp | 1) Adopts 4 pairs of long-life carbon arc lamps with a continuous service life of 78 hours 2) Discharge voltage and current: 50V±2V, 60A±2A 3) Carbon rods: Upper carbon rod SLM-U (Φ36×410mm); Lower carbon rod SLE-L (Φ23×410mm) 4) Filter glass: 164×303mm |

Prohibited Tests for This Equipment
Tests on flammable, explosive, or volatile substance samples; tests or storage of corrosive substance samples; tests or storage of biological samples; tests or storage of samples with strong electromagnetic emission sources.
